    I have put show tv episodes on a dvd+RW. I was wondering if there is any way to extract these files from the DVD. There are 4 VOB files around 1 gig each. Each one containing some of the 9 episodes I burned. What I want to know is there any way to extract the MPGs that I put on there in the complete form.

    you can't extract the mpgs, you can extract the VOBs. the process is called ripping. you can do this with a number of software utilities. Some of the most popular are Smart Ripper and DVD decrypter, both of which can be found in the software section at http://www.afterdawn.com/software/
